What are the MCC and MNC codes in Bahrain?
Every mobile network in Bahrain shares Mobile Country Code (MCC) 426 — the three-digit prefix that opens every PLMN broadcast by a Bahrain SIM. The country's international dialling prefix is +973, which is distinct from the MCC: 426 identifies the country inside the network, while +973 routes voice calls. Under ISO 3166 Bahrain is coded BH / BHR / 048. This page lists 6 mobile networks across 7 PLMN codes operating in Bahrain, with each network's MNC, full PLMN, operator, status and market share.
| MCC | MNC | PLMN | Operator | Status | Market share |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 426 | 01, 05 | 42601, 42605 | Batelco Bahrain Telecommunications Company | Operational | — |
| 426 | 02 | 42602 | zain BH Zain Bahrain | Operational | — |
| 426 | 03 | 42603 | Civil Aviation Authority | Unknown | — |
| 426 | 04 | 42604 | stc Stc Bahrain | Operational | — |
| 426 | 06 | 42606 | stc Stc Bahrain | Unknown | — |
| 426 | 07 | 42607 | TAIF | Unknown | — |

- How do I read a Bahrain PLMN?
- A PLMN such as 42601 is simply the MCC and MNC joined together: 426 (Bahrain) followed by 01 (Batelco). The first three digits are always the country's MCC; the remaining two or three digits are the network's MNC.
